نرم افزارهای کاربردی تحت اکسل و اکسس

انجام پروژه های سفارشی تحت اکسل ، اکسس و کلیه امور حسابداری به صورت پاره وقت

اضافه کردن توضیحات به توابع ایجاد شده توسط کاربر (UDF)
نویسنده : علی گنجی - ساعت ٥:٤٠ ‎ب.ظ روز دوشنبه ٢٢ خرداد ۱۳٩۱
 

آیا می خواهید برای توابع خود در محیط اکسل ، راهنما و توضیحات درج نمائید ؟

وقتی برای فرمول نویسی بر روی FX کلیک می کنیم ، در پنجره باز شده  (Insert Function) برای هر تابع توضیحاتی مختصر وجود دارد که ما را در مقدار دهی آرگومانهای توابع یاری می کند و همچنین با مقدار دهی آرگومانها ، خروجی تابع را نیز نمایش می دهد .

در تابع های ایجاد شده توسط کاربر (UDF) این توضیحات وجود ندارد و سایر کاربران را در استفاده از آنها با مشکل مواجه می کند .

برای اضافه کردن توضیحات به توابع ایجاد شده توسط کاربر ، به یکی از روشهای زیر عمل می کنیم :

روش اول :

1- ابتدا تابع خود را ایجاد کنید .

2- کد های زیر را محیط Module برنامه کپی نمائید :

Sub Insert_Help_For_Function ()

Application.MacroOption Macro:= " نام تابع",Description:= " توضیحات تابع "

End sub

3- مقادیر  " نام تابع " و " توضیحات تابع " را به دلخواه تغییر دهید و کلید F5 فشار دهید . (Run Sub) 

نام تابعی که نوشته می شود باید قبلا ایجاد شده باشد .

روش دوم :

1- ابتدا تابع خود را ایجاد کنید .

2- از منوی Developer گزینه Macros را انتخاب نمائید .

3- در پنچره باز شده و در قسمت Macro Name نام تابع ایجاد شده را وارد نمائید . اگر تابعی با نام وارد شده قبلا ایجاد شده باشد ، گزینه Options فعال می گردد و می توانید بر روی آن کلیک نمائید .

4- بر روی گزینه Options کلیک نمائید . در پنجره باز شده و در قسمت Description توضیحات مربوط به تابع را وارد نموده و بر روی گزینه Ok کلیک و سپس پنجره Macro را ببندید .

 

پس از انجام هر یک از روشها ، چنانچه از طریق FX تابع خود را انتخاب نمائید ، راهنمای درج شده را خواهید دید .

اگر هم می خواهید توضیحات شما به صورت کاملا حرفه ای و با فایل Help و دارای مثال و ... باشد ( مانند توابع خود اکسل ) سری به سایت http://www.ec-software.com بزنید .